The IQAir GCX Chemisorber offers 20% more air delivery than the GC and is an advanced air cleaning device for the control of formaldehyde, hydrogen sulfide, sulfur dioxide and particulates.
Applications
- Chemical Control of the following: Acetaldehyde, Acetylene, Arsine, Carbon dioxide, Ethylene, Formaldehyde, Hydrazine, Hydrogen cyanide, Hydrogen sulfide, Nitric Oxide, Nitrogen dioxide, Phosphine, Silane, Sulfur dioxide

Customized Gas and Odor Control The GCX Chemisorber is compact and customized for specific gaseous contaminants and odors. Just like a professional gas mask, IQAir maximizes filter efficiency for different gases and odors by offering the right filter cartridge. And while gas and odor control is a particular strength of these systems, the GC Series also offers excellent filtration efficiency for particles.
Gas Cartridge Technology The IQAir GCX Chemisorber uses four reusable filter cartridges to hold up to 12 lbs. of gas phase media. The cylindrical shape of these cartridges allows for optimum contact between the air and gas phase media, which ensure high removal efficiencies. The large surface area of the cartridges enables high air flow rates. Since IQAir gas filter cartridges are reusable, replacing them is not only economical, but also environmentally friendly.
High-Efficiency Particulate Filtration The particulate filtration GCX units complements the gaseous filtration process by removing over 97% of particles before they can reach the gas phase media. This increases the efficiency and life of the media by preventing its pores from clogging. The GC units' overall filtration efficiency for particles is 97% at .3 microns. The post filter is electrostatically charged to trap particulate pollutants and microorganisms (bacteria and viruses). | ||||||||||||||||||||||||||||||||||||||||||||||||||||||||
